We're looking for a driven Application Support Engineer to join my client and help deliver exceptional support for business-critical applications. If you enjoy problem-solving, working with clients, and collaborating with developers to deliver real solutions—this could be the role for you.
What You'll Be Doing
- Providing technical support and resolving application issues within agreed SLAs
- Troubleshooting and managing client tickets from start to resolution
- Working closely with stakeholders, analysts, and developers
- Communicating clearly with clients and delivering excellent customer service
- Gathering requirements for system changes (RFCs) and supporting their delivery
- Testing, documenting, and supporting application updates
- Assisting with debugging and implementing improvements (training provided)
- Contributing to team development and continuous improvement initiatives
